When Ron Rothenbuhler’s daughter, Isabella, had a positive experience at School of Rock in Ann Arbor, a major improvement in her drumming skills was just one outcome of her lessons. Rothenbuhler was also so inspired by the School of Rock’s effectiveness that he is now opening his own branch of the franchise in Levis Commons to provide the same opportunity to other local students. After receiving approval for the School of Rock’s final design around January 2023, Rothebuhler is hopeful the location will be open in late June.
The first School of Rock (now a worldwide franchise) location was opened in Philadelphia by a traditional rock instructor named Paul Green, who found that students learn music better when they learn new skills in a band setting. Since Green opened the first location, School of Rock has expanded to 300 locations across the country.
The Perrysburg location will teach students guitar, drums, bass, piano, and vocals, as well as feature classes for songwriting and performing. The location will feature several rehearsal spaces and two drum rooms.
At Perrysburg’s School of Rock, classes generally follow the same structure of one weekly private lesson combined with one group rehearsal. Introducing the Super Cool Create Kit
Igniting Creativity and Problem-Solving Skills in Kids
Anthony Wayne Innovation & Design is thrilled to announce the launch of the Super Cool Create Kit, a STEAM project kit designed to empower children and foster their creative problem-solving skills. This innovative kit, developed by Bowling Green State University (BGSU) graduates, combines elements of art, design, and engineering to provide an engaging and educational experience for young minds.
The Super Cool Create Kit offers a comprehensive package of materials and guidance to inspire children to explore their creativity and develop essential STEAM skills. Inside the box, kids will find pre-cut cardboard pieces, googly eyes, paper straws, pipe cleaners, adhesives, and inspiration sheets to guide them through the problem-solving process. For parents and educators, detailed instructions ensure a seamless experience as they engage with children during the planning, building, and presentation stages.
This project has been made possible by the collaboration of two talented BGSU graduates, Mike Vanderpool and Michael Clink. They harnessed their passion for creativity and learning to create a kit that would revolutionize how children approach problem-solving. Utilizing the cutting-edge resources of the BGSU Collab Lab, they developed and refined prototypes of the Super Cool Create Kit, ensuring its effectiveness and educational value.

Through a series of play tests and iterative design processes, Vanderpool and his daughter, Pippa, have fine-tuned the Super Cool Create Kit to deliver an outstanding experience. Starting from the ground zero of printing various pieces for building, they progressed through prototypes, optimizing the kit’s components and exploring safe and effective ways for children to connect the pieces. The just-released Mark III Prototype will be shared through a Kickstarter crowdfunding program, with the proceeds used to finalize the assembly of the kit, the pieces, and additional resources such as videos to help adults and children maximize the experience with the kit.
